Captured Guinea Hens

 
They would run through our yard.
 
A flock of 20
 
One day four of them branched off and stayed here.
 
We ate one.
 
They are tough.
 
The other three joined our flock of roosters.
 
They would fly into the back trees each time we went outside.
 
Slept back there.
 
Always returning after breakfast was served, and would chase away the Roosters to get a share.
 
We had to borrow traps to get them penned.
 
Flighty and nervous birds.
 
What will we do with them now?

We went to visit friends and brought some Pink Lemonade Cupcakes.  My 5 year old decided to draw a picture of one of them.  It is my artwork today.

However I must say- the best part of the cupcake was the frosting:  1 package of cream cheese, half a package of Kool-Aid Pink Lemonade, 1 TBSP cream, and about 3 cups of powered sugar.  After I mixed it together, I put it in a baggie and squeezed it onto the cupcakes. 

The cupcakes themselves came from a box mix- Pink Lemonade cake mix- made with milk instead of water, butter instead of oil, and 3 whole eggs.  The milk and butter make the box mix taste a bit more homemade.
